On Sat, Jul 05, 2003 at 11:14:45PM -0700, Michael Greb wrote:

> This is a slight one line change to the SQL query used to populate the
> list of sources in the ./setup application.  When the name of a source is
> NULL in the database, Unnamed will be displayed instead of a blank line.
> I spent some time on IRC helping someone fix a multiple channels problem
> because he didn't realize he had multiple sources with no name.  I had a
> similar problem when I first setup MythTV because I wasn't familiar with
> the key mapping and hit enter at the wrong time.  Perhaps this could be
> committed to CVS?

How did he end up with unnamed sources?  Perhaps a check should be added to
disallow creating them this way in the first place, as it makes diagnosis
difficult.
